Mordecai

Patricia Hasz February 7, 2019

THIS KID.

Some of you that are taking the time to look at these photos have been following along with Mordecai’s story. For those that haven’t, a little bit of background story: Cai was diagnosed with spina bifida around 20 weeks and has been fighting all of the odds ever since. His diagnosis required surgery be done while he was still in the womb in order to close the opening in his back. His parents, Krissy & Titus, who live in Portland, decided to spend the remaining time of the pregnancy in Minneapolis where the surgery would be performed. Luckily, this was able to bring them closer to being near family and lots and lots of love and support. The surgery went incredibly well, but the fight wasn’t over. The last month of the pregnancy, Krissy was admitted to the hospital for monitoring, until a c-section was scheduled at 34 weeks. Cai was born at a whopping 4 lbs 1 oz. He kicked butt when it came to doing everything he needed to in order to be allowed to go home. When released from the hospital, I was lucky enough to meet him before they all headed back to Oregon, which they had to do by train because of oxygen levels on an airplane. Cai, his sister, and his parents are back in Portland now and doing well. Poor little dude is unfortunately likely to have health issues come up every now and again, but based on how well he has done so far, I have no doubt he will be an amazing kid. I am so, so, so happy for his family and wish the very best for them.
